Output 2289c3b90dacdf5b839a0b6dc20d95fc1159b0d092b21c8cec9a7225d44d7636:7

value
37139609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54a454fdcc4436c8ad06c636ceb40ab6b1dedfca OP_EQUAL
address
MFchrXmakAbnrGw7ESLM2BntfMdCqh7xTv
transaction
2289c3b90dacdf5b839a0b6dc20d95fc1159b0d092b21c8cec9a7225d44d7636
spent
true